The U.S. Department of Transportation reported the number of speeding-related crash fatalities for the 20 days of the year that had the highest number of these fatalities between 1994 and 2003 (Traffic Safety Facts, July 2005).

1419_number of speeding-related crash fatalities.png

a. Compute the mean number of speeding-related fatalities for these 20 days.

b. Compute the median number of speeding-related fatalities for these 20 days.

c. Explain why it is not reasonable to generalize from this sample of 20 days to the other 345 days of the year.
